The Finova Connect is aimed at making driving safer and allowing owners to understand their cars better.

A Ukrainian company has created a device that fits into the vehicle's on-board-diagnostics port and gives advice on faults, history and safety.

The Finova Connect is aimed at making driving safer and allowing owners to understand their cars better. Any driver can plug the small transmitter into their car's OBD port that will send information back, including tracking, condition, errors and even messages from businesses such as insurance companies. It also uses statistical algorithms, data mining and machine learning to evaluate the driver's behavior pattern.

The product will be distributed in late march at about 200 dollars and 5 dollars a month for subscription. The technology is an individual application, but a platform which is open for other IT-developers, motor companies and insurance groups worldwide
